About the Role
You will own the vision, roadmap, and feature development for the core B2B restaurant management platform. This role requires deep user empathy, frequent on-site research in restaurants, and the ability to lead a remote-first team through clear, written communication.
Responsibilities
- Own the vision, strategy, and roadmap for the TC Manager dashboard.
- Conduct regular on-site research with restaurant staff to identify product opportunities.
- Define product requirements and partner with engineering and design teams on implementation.
- Utilize AI tools to build and validate prototypes with real operators.
- Author clear PRDs, problem statements, and decision documentation.
- Prioritize features across reservations, table management, guest data, and system integrations.
- Collaborate with Consulting, Onboarding, and Sales teams to ensure feature adoption.
- Track and report on outcome metrics such as adoption, task completion, and NPS.
- Coordinate product launches across Japanese and English markets.
